Building Real-Time REST APIs with Spring Boot - Blog App
Build REST APIs using Spring Boot, Spring Security 6, JWT, Spring Data JPA, Hibernate, MySQL, Docker & Deploy on AWS
4.46 (3126 reviews)

25 547
students
36.5 hours
content
Jan 2025
last update
$94.99
regular price
What you will learn
Learn Building Rest API’s for Blog App Using Spring Boot, Spring Security, JWT, Spring Data JPA (Hibernate), MySQL Database.
Learn How to Build CRUD REST APIs in Spring Boot Project
Learn How to Build CRUD REST API's for ONE-TO-MANY Relationship - /posts/{postId}/comments/{commentId}
Learn How to Build REST APIs for Pagination and Sorting in Spring Boot Project
Learn How to Build REST API's for Search / Filter REST API in Spring Boot Project
Learn How to Build REST API’s for Login and Signup in Spring Boot Project
Learn How to Use Lombok Library
Learn How to Use DTO’s
Learn Spring Boot REST API Exception Handling
Learn Spring Boot REST API Validation
Learn How to Use Spring Security in Spring Boot Project and How to Perform In-Memory and DB Authentication and Authorization
Learn How to Secure REST APIs ( Role Based Security) in Spring Boot Project
Learn How to Write Query Methods Using Spring Data JPA
Learn One-To-Many and Many-To-Many JPA/Hibernate Mappings
Learn How to Test REST API’s using Postman REST Client
Learn What is JWT, How it Works and How to configure JWT ( JSON Web Token) in Spring Security
Learn How to Use JWT with Login API and secure REST APIs using JWT
Learn Important 4 Versioning REST API Strategies
Learn REST APIs Documentation with Swagger UI
Test Spring Boot REST APIs with JWT using Swagger UI
Learn Customizing Swagger REST Documentation with Annotations
Learn How to Add Profiles the Spring Boot Project
Learn Transaction Management with Spring Boot and Spring Data JPA
Learn How to Deploy Spring Boot Blog App on AWS Cloud (Production)
Learn Spring Data JPA Fundamentals
Dockering Spring Boot Application Step by Step
Dockering Spring Boot MySQL CRUD Application Step by Step
Docker Compose - Dockering Spring Boot MySQL CRUD Application Step by Step
Course Gallery




Charts
Students
Price
Rating & Reviews
Enrollment Distribution
Comidoc Review
Our Verdict
Building Real-Time REST APIs with Spring Boot - Blog App, led by Ramesh Fadtare, offers a thorough journey into the world of REST API development using Spring Boot. With its balanced approach towards theory and practice, this 36.5-hour course provides numerous advantages for learners of varying skill levels. However, audio quality inconsistencies in some videos, alongside certain omissions in specific areas, may present slight challenges to a few students—as could the introduction of AWS and Docker late in the course. Nevertheless, with Ramesh's clear explanations and real-world insights, this Udemy bestseller proves to be an invaluable resource for any serious learner aiming to bolster their REST API skills.
What We Liked
- Comprehensive coverage of REST API concepts using Spring Boot, with updates to new Spring boot versions
- Clear explanations of key concepts, suitable for both beginners and experienced programmers
- Instructor provides valuable insights on enterprise applications with real-world context
- Hands-on experience in JWT configuration, exception handling, and testing APIs using Postman
Potential Drawbacks
- Audio quality issues in some videos, although instructor has taken steps to improve it
- AWS and Docker sections could be overwhelming for those unfamiliar with the technologies
- Certain topics like exception handling and code specifics might not be well covered for absolute beginners
- Teaching style may seem dry or fast-paced for some learners
Related Topics
4261034
udemy ID
24/08/2021
course created date
01/10/2021
course indexed date
Bot
course submited by